Core
Sencera Core 801S is a state-of-the-art system-on-a-chip (SoC) designed for embedded systems that require high performance and low power consumption. It combines four processor cores – ARM Cortex-A53, Cortex-M3, Cortex-M4, and Cortex-M7 – with highly integrated peripherals and onboard FPGA fabric. The integrated FPGA fabric provides the flexibility to support custom designs for unique or specific applications. Key features of the 801S CoreSoC include:
1. Quad-core ARM Cortex-A53 processor: Maximum clock speed of 1.5 GHz and 32KB/32KB L1/L2 cache with hardware virtualization support.
2. Dual-core Cortex-M3/M4 MCU: Maximum clock speed of 200MHz, with up to 2 MB of flash memory and 128 KB of SRAM.
3. Cortex-M7 MCU: Maximum clock speed of 250MHz, with up to 4MB of flash memory and 256KB of SRAM.
4. Onboard FPGA fabric: Xilinx Artix-7 FPGA featuring twelve 3.125Gbps transceivers and fifty functions blocks.
5. Exceptional memory capabilities: Two DDR3/DDR3L SDRAM controllers and two DDR3/DDR3L-LPDDR3 controllers with maximum system RAM up to 2GB.
6. Rich connectivity support: Six PCIe Gen2 x1 and two USB 3.0 OTG ports for external device access.
7. Comprehensive digital interface support: HDMI/MIPI-DSI/Camera/LCD display capability and support for multiple audio codec.
8. Various power options: DC-DC converters with Power-over-Ethernet (PoE) support, and reconfigurable power step consuming as low as 130mW.
